## 内容主体大纲### 一、引言- 描述数字货币的兴起- 阐明钱包与区块链的重要性- 讨论研究的目的和意义### 二、区块链...
比特币自2009年问世以来,已经发展成为全球最为知名的数字货币之一。随着越来越多的人开始了解和使用比特币,钱包地址的概念也越来越受到重视。钱包地址是比特币网络中至关重要的组成部分,它不仅仅是一个简单的字符串,而是用户数字资产的入口。
在这篇文章中,我们将深入探讨比特币钱包地址的编码方式,从基础概念到实际应用,将为您提供全面的理解和知识。
#### 2. 比特币地址的基本概念比特币钱包地址是一个由数字和字母组成的字符串,用户可以向这个地址发送比特币。它实际上是比特币公钥经过一系列加密和编码后的结果,用户可以通过它接收和查看自己的比特币余额。
钱包地址的主要作用是接受比特币。无论是进行在线购物、投资、还是进行交易,用户都需要提供一个钱包地址给对方,以完成比特币的转账。另外,钱包地址也可以用于查询交易记录和余额。
#### 3. 比特币钱包地址的编码方式比特币钱包地址主要使用Base58Check编码方式。这种编码方式的优势在于它能够生成较短的地址,而且避免了容易混淆的字符(如数字“0”和字母“O”)。Base58Check编码的具体流程包括对公钥进行SHA-256和RIPEMD-160哈希运算,然后使用Checksum进行校验,最后通过Base58编码生成地址。
除了Base58Check编码外,还存在Hex和WIF(Wallet Import Format)等编码方式。Hex编码是表示公钥的十六进制格式,而WIF则用于导入和导出钱包密钥。虽然它们各自有不同的用途,但在比特币交易中,Base58Check是最常用的格式。
#### 4. 比特币地址的格式P2PKH地址(Pay-to-Public-Key-Hash)是比特币最传统的地址格式,通常以“1”开头。它是通过公钥哈希生成的,包含了用户的比特币余额信息。
P2SH地址(Pay-to-Script-Hash)则是另一种地址格式,通常以“3”开头。它允许将复杂的脚本(如多重签名)嵌入到地址中,这样使得与多方合作的交易更加灵活。
Bech32地址是比特币的最新地址格式,通常以“bc1”开头,这种格式为“Segregated Witness”(隔离见证)引入,能够降低交易费用并提高网络效率。
#### 5. 如何生成比特币钱包地址生成比特币钱包地址并不复杂,用户可以使用专门的钱包应用来创建新的地址,过程一般包括生成私钥,然后根据所选择的编码方式生成公钥和地址。
许多知名的钱包软件(如Electrum、Exodus等)提供了用户友好的界面来自动生成比特币地址。用户只需下载钱包,按照提示进行操作即可轻松获取自己的钱包地址。
#### 6. 钱包地址的安全性与隐私比特币的交易虽然在区块链上是公开透明的,但为了保护用户的隐私,保持钱包地址的匿名性是非常重要的。如果地址被公开,别人就可以追踪到相关的交易记录和余额。
用户可通过多种方式保护自己的钱包地址,例如定期更换地址、使用多重签名钱包、保持私钥的安全等。还应尽量避免在社交媒体上公开自己的比特币地址,以防止数据泄露。
#### 7. 常见问题解答 以下是围绕比特币钱包地址编码方式的6个相关问题,我们将为每个问题逐一详细介绍: **比特币钱包地址的长度和格式是怎样的?**比特币钱包地址的长度通常在26到35字符之间,具体取决于地址的编码格式。常见的P2PKH地址以“1”开头,长度通常为34个字符,而P2SH地址以“3”开头,长度也是34个字符。新的Bech32地址以“bc1”开头,长度可能更短或更长,不同的格式设计可以提高可识别性和使用的便利性。
对于比特币钱包用户来说,掌握这些基本常识很重要,因为在进行交易时,地址的格式会直接影响到资金的发送和接收。如果用户输入错误的地址格式,可能会导致资金的永久性丢失。因此,确保您使用正确的地址格式就显得极为重要。
**如何从比特币地址中获取公共密钥和私钥?**要从比特币地址获取公共密钥和私钥,您需要先理解这两者之间的关系。通常,私钥是您钱包的核心,因此必须妥善保管,而公共密钥和比特币地址则是公开的。
当您创建比特币钱包时,钱包软件会自动生成私钥,并通过相应的算法生成公共密钥。在某些钱包中,您可以直接查看或导出公共密钥。而私钥则更为隐私,通常以WIF(Wallet Import Format)格式存储,用户需要确保私钥不被泄露,因为任何人持有您的私钥都可以使用您钱包中的比特币。
虽然用户可以通过钱包软件轻松找到自己的公共密钥,但为了安全起见,不建议将私钥暴露给他人。理想情况下,私钥应该存储在离线环境中,或者使用硬件钱包进行存储,以防范因电子设备感染病毒而导致的资金损失。
**比特币地址是否可以重复使用?**相比于传统银行账户,使用比特币钱包地址时候的一个主要区别是,该地址在技术上可以重复使用。然而,从隐私和安全的角度考虑,建议用户尽量避免重复使用同一地址,尤其是从同一来源反复接收比特币时。每次交易时生成新的地址可以提高匿名性,但用户需要确保能够跟踪和管理更换后的地址。
重复使用地址会使得交易历史对外界更加透明,可能导致隐私泄露。如果一个地址多次用于接收金额,则可以通过区块链分析工具轻松追踪到您的相关交易。因此,建议用户在每次交易后生成新的地址,这样能更好地保护自己的资产。
**比特币钱包如何储存与恢复?**比特币钱包的存储与恢复通常涉及保护私钥的措施。用户一般会选择将钱包文件保存在电脑、手机或硬件钱包中。保证钱包资产安全的关键在于私钥的保存,建议利用纸钱包或硬件钱包等离线存储方法进行保护,每次确认账户余额时应非常小心。
在需要恢复比特币钱包时,您通常需要使用助记词或恢复短语。这些是生成私钥的随机字符序列,恢复钱包时输入助记词后,钱包就会重新生成与之对应的私钥及比特币地址。如果助记词丢失,可能会造成资产的不必要损失。因此,建议用户在保管时切忌随意存放,应尽量写在纸上并放置在安全的地方。
**比特币交易的处理时间如何?**比特币交易的处理时间通常受到多个因素的影响,包括网络拥堵、矿工费用(交易手续费设置)、区块确认时间等。在正常情况下,提交交易后,矿工会将其纳入待处理交易池,根据费用高低进行优先处理,越高的手续费具备越高的被确认优先权。
交易确认的时间可在几分钟到几个小时不等,尤其在网络拥堵时期,用户需要适当提高手续费以提高交易成功率。因此,交易者应该在进行大额交易前确认网络状态和费用水平,以便及时调整手续费,提高确认效率,减少不必要的延误。
**如何选择比特币钱包?**选择适合的比特币钱包需要考虑多个因素,例如使用便捷、安全性、平台支持、费用、数据备份等。根据使用场景,用户可以选择硬件钱包、桌面钱包或者移动钱包,硬件钱包虽然安全性较高但相对不够便捷,而桌面和移动钱包则体积小且易于操作。
在安全性方面,选择对私钥进行本地存储的钱包是非常重要的,同时要确保设备安全,无病毒和恶意软件。用户也可以查看钱包的社区评价和开发背景,选择知名度较高且有良好声誉的产品。对于比特币新手,使用用户友好的钱包可能更加合适,而对于高级用户,则可能更偏向于具备更多功能的专业钱包。
总之,选择比特币钱包时应综合考虑使用习惯、资产安全和个人需求,从中找到最适合您的选项,以保证安全的同时,能方便地进行比特币的使用与交易。
### 结语通过上述内容,我们详细探讨了比特币钱包地址的编码方式,包括基本概念、编码方式、地址格式、安全性及如何选择合适钱包。其中的每一步都关系到用户的资金安全和使用便利性,希望广大比特币用户能对钱包地址有更深入的理解和运用。无论您是比特币的新手还是经验丰富的投资者,了解钱包地址的机制都是提高您在这个数字货币世界中成功的重要一步。